Transaction e954b47599781e136486f5fa45bf0bdde8f3311d1daef69fcd7f3ecd60d7760a

1 Input
2 Outputs
  • e954b47599781e136486f5fa45bf0bdde8f3311d1daef69fcd7f3ecd60d7760a:0
  • value  2585580
    address  32rvxSBpHmk1uCxfGK5vwwWND5LhfpgDJK
  • e954b47599781e136486f5fa45bf0bdde8f3311d1daef69fcd7f3ecd60d7760a:1
  • value  4676076
    address  1HJ1WEr3WpGnF8z7z6EpJcvdCwDVZDARFy